Borja Moll Moré

Digital Health Expert - Roche Farma S.A., Spain

Borja is building his career within the healthcare ecosystem, with over 10 years of international experience in digital health and data-driven solutions across Europe. His career has spanned both the pharmaceutical and diagnostic sectors, where he has held key roles in sales, marketing, business development, medical affairs, and product management.

He has worked for leading organisations such as Roche Pharma, Roche Diagnostics, and IBM Consulting, contributing to the design and execution of transformative healthcare initiatives. His interdisciplinary profile has enabled him to navigate the complex interface between clinical needs, cutting-edge technology, and sustainable business models.

Throughout his career, Borja has led cross-functional teams focused on delivering impactful digital health solutions—from strategy and development to real-world implementation. His work has particularly centred on unlocking the value of clinical and real-world data to improve patient outcomes, streamline care processes, and support evidence-based decision-making across healthcare systems.

He is currently involved in several strategic projects that aim to integrate digital platforms, advanced analytics, and artificial intelligence into the care pathway, especially in therapeutic areas such as ophthalmology and oncology.

An engineer by training, Borja holds a Bachelor's degree in Telecommunications Engineering and a Master's degree in ICT Management from La Salle – Ramon Llull University in Barcelona. He also earned an Executive MBA from IESE Business School. This background has equipped him with a unique combination of technical, strategic, and leadership capabilities to drive innovation in complex and highly regulated environments.

Alongside his corporate journey, Borja has also contributed to the entrepreneurship ecosystem, supporting digital health start-ups and fostering collaboration between academia, industry, and healthcare providers.
